About
Pramod Jadhav is a robotics researcher specializing in bioinspired underwater vehicle design and multi-robot swarm coordination. His work bridges theoretical modeling with practical implementation, focusing on two key areas: biomimetic propulsion systems and distributed robotic exploration. Jadhav’s research on Biomimetic Autonomous Underwater Vehicles (BAUVs) introduces mathematical frameworks for flapping-fin propulsion, inspired by the efficient, silent locomotion of marine fishes. This work addresses critical gaps in modeling bioinspired underwater dynamics, offering potential advances in stealthy aquatic navigation and energy-efficient exploration. In parallel, his studies on swarm-based exploration employ ROS frameworks to enable coordinated multi-robot teams for tasks like environmental monitoring and disaster response.
